DELICIOUS SIOMAI


A traditional Chinese dumpling. This popular dumpling has made its way to the heart of the Filipino’s as evidenced by the hundreds of stalls, eateries, and restaurants who serve them. Traditionally cooked through steaming, siomai nowadays are also served fried complimented with soy sauce and calamansi.

1 kg ground pork (suggested proportion of fat to lean meat is 1:3)
1/3 cup chopped water chestnuts or turnips (singkamas)
1/3 cup chopped carrots
2 medium or 1 large minced onion(s)
bunch of spring onions or leeks
1 egg
5 tablespoons sesame oil
1 teaspoon freshly ground pepper
1 teaspoon salt
50 pcs. large or 100 pcs. small wanton or siomai wrapper
soy sauce, calamansi (lemon or kumquats), sesame oil and chilli paste (for the sauce) 

Wrapper:
1/4 cup water
1 egg
1 tablespoon vegetable or corn oil
1/4 teaspoon salt
1 1/2 cups all-purpose flour

Mix all the ingredients for the filling in a bowl.
Spoon 1 tablespoon of mixture into each wrapper. Fold and seal.
Meanwhile, boil water and brush steamer with oil.
When the water gets to a rolling boil, arrange the siomai in the steamer and let stand for 15-20 minutes, longer for larger pieces.
Serve with soy sauce, calamansi and sesame oil. Chilli past is optional.
Update: Someone asked me for the recipe of chilli paste and siomai wrapper that’s why I’m reproducing it here.

Wrapper:
Beat egg and mix with flour till free of lumps.
Bring water, cooking oil and salt to a boil, then pour in flour.
Remove from heat and beat until mixture forms a ball.
Divide the dough into 1 1/4 -inch balls.
Roll each ball on a floured board until paper thin. Set aside.
Simplest version of chilli sauce would be to chop chillies well and fry them in oil, sesame or vegetable oil, never olive oil if you want it to have an Asian taste.

The chilli paste found in restaurants is a combination of chillies, garlic and oil. Combine chopped chillies and mashed garlic then simmer for around 20 minutes or till most of the water has evaporated. Add oil, simmer and stir well. 

Healthy tip For a healthier siomai, use very lean ground pork and increase the proportion of vegetable. You can also add mushrooms and shrimps. If you do, you may need to add one more egg to help bind the mixture.

Tasting tip  Don’t forget to check the seasoning by microwaving a spoonful before wrapping with siomai wrapper. Adjust the salt and pepper, if necessary.

USA BASKETBALL MEN'S OLYMPIC'S TEAM MAKES GOLD


Team USA picked up their second consecutive gold medal at the 2012 London Summer Olympics over Spain in a narrow margin of victory of 107-100.

The final game in the North Greenwich Arena saw Kevin Durant continue his scoring success with 30 points, giving the Oklahoma City Thunder player a total of 156 points most points scored throughout the London Olympics, but just one point less than Argentina's and San Antonio Spurs' Emanuel "Manu" Ginobili with 155 total points.

The United States beat Spain 107-100 Sunday morning to win their second straight gold medal in Olympic basketball.

Mike Krzyzewski gets to ride off into the sunset from his Olympic coaching career, getting his second gold medal and finishing his career as Team USA’s coach with a 62-1 record.

The game was very reminiscent of the 2008 gold medal game. Spain came out playing better than they had all Olympics and trailed by just one point entering the fourth quarter.

Team USA came out great in the fourth though scoring seven quick points. Then LeBron James picked up his fourth foul, came out of the game and Spain remained within striking distance.

When LeBron came back in, he made a backbreaking 3-pointer over Marc Gasol in the same way Kobe Bryant made a huge three four years ago.

LeBron James caps off an amazing year for him that included an MVP, NBA title and now gold medal making him the first player since Michael Jordan in 1992 to do that. Pau Gasol led Spain with 24 points, eight rebounds and five assists in the game.

The U.S. made the plays they needed to down the stretch. It wasn’t the prettiest win. Each team committed 27 fouls in the game and Spain also battled foul trouble with Marc Gasol picking up four in the first half and sitting the entire third quarter.

The U.S. made 15-of-37 threes in the game while Spain wasn’t as good at 7-for-19. Team USA also held their own on the boards outrebounding Spain and getting 12 offensive rebounds.With the win, the United States capture their 14th gold medal in Olympic basketball history.

BRAD AND ANGELINA WEDDING RUMORS FLARE UP

Forget garden-variety buzz. The possibility that Brad Pitt is marrying Angelina Jolie this weekend in France is getting "real buzz." So says an excited but unnamed source to the U.K's Sun, based on rumors that the couple are hosting some kind of event at their château with guests including Pitt's parents and Jolie's engagement-ring jeweler. But multiple sources tell People there is no wedding this weekend. The local newspaper Var Matin also shot down a France 3 TV report of a Saturday wedding. And officials in the village say they don't know anything about it and that it likely couldn't happen anyway. "Under French law couples have to get married at the town hall," Patrick Mareschi, deputy culture secretary of the nearby village of Correns, tells Reuters. "Unlike with a religious wedding, there's no way a couple can hold a civil ceremony at their own home." Which is pretty much what the photo agency X17 found out. It grumbled on its website: "We sent an X17 photographer all the way down to the south of France - it's pretty much in the middle of nowhere - to check out Brad Pitt and Angelina Jolie's chateau Miraval to see just what's going on and ... drumroll, please ... there's Nothing going on!" the site says. Not only did its photographer not find any signs the couple, engaged last spring, were tying the knot - no security guards, no party planners - it didn't even see evidence of other rumors that Pitt was hosting a wedding anniversary party for his parents. 

HOW TO COOK SPECIAL CHAMPORADO


A simple and easy steps to cook.

Champorado is a sweet chocolate rice porridge that uses sweet glutinous rice (locally known as malagkit) and cocoa powder as main ingredients. A more traditional approach would be using tableya (pure cocoa blocks) instead of cocoa powder.

Ingredients:
8 tbsp cocoa powder (or about 4 pieces tableya)
1 cup glutinous rice (malagkit)
1/2 cup sugar
3  1/2 cups water
condensed milk (optional)

Cooking procedure:
1. Pour 2 1/2 cups of water in a pot and bring to a boil
2. Put-in the glutinous rice and allow water to re-boil for a few minutes
3. Dilute the cocoa powder in 1 cup warm water then pour-in the pot. Stir continously
4. Once the glutinous rice is cooked (about 12 to 18 minutes of cooking with constant stirring), add the sugar and cook for another 5 minutes or until the texture becomes thick.
5. Remove from the pot and place in a serving bowl.
6. Serve hot with a swirl of condensed milk on top.

JUNK FOOD DIET ON PREGNANT WOMEN


Pregnant women who gorge on junk food could be putting themselves at an increased risk of breast cancer that is passed down generations, say researchers.

In their rat-based study, researchers at Georgetown Lombardi Comprehensive Cancer Center showed that pregnant females that ate a high fat diet not only increased breast cancer risk in their female daughters but also in that daughter's offspring.


A DIET laden in fat during pregnancy may lead to an increased risk of breast cancer that is passed down generations, say scientists.

Pregnant women who dine on junk food could unwittingly be risking the future health of not only their daughters but also their grand-daughters, research suggests.

The US study, conducted on rats, provides further evidence that environmental factors can cause inheritable genetic changes. Scientists believe the findings have an important message for humans.

"The implications from this study are that pregnant mothers need to eat a well-balanced diet because they may be affecting the future health of their daughters and granddaughters," said lead researcher Sonia de Assis, from Georgetown University in Washington DC.

The researchers fed a group of mother rats either a high-fat or normal diet and looked at what happened to their offspring and the subsequent generation.

They found that not only did a high-fat diet increase the risk of daughters having breast cancer, but also granddaughters.

The risk was not only passed on by daughters but also sons.

Daughters of male and female rats who both had fat-consuming mothers had an 80pc chance of developing breast cancer.

But the risk fell to 69pc if the mother of one parent -- either father or mother -- had a high-fat diet and the other grandmother had a normal diet during pregnancy.

Granddaughters of grandmother rats given a normal diet had a 50pc chance of developing breast cancer. The scientists cannot explain how diet influences breast cancer risk down two generations but believe "epigenetic" factors are involved. These are genetic changes caused by the environment that can potentially be passed on to future generations of offspring.

In the rats, something linked to diet made it more likely for "terminal end buds" -- structures where tumours can develop -- to appear in the breast tissue of daughters and granddaughters.

BEER, A GOOD OR BAD TO YOUR HEALTH?



Most men drink Beer because it makes you feel good. You knew that. But you don't realize just how good. Recent research has revealed bioactive compounds in beer that battle cancer, boost your metabolism, and more. And these benefits come on top of the oft-touted upsides of moderate alcohol intake: clot prevention, cleaner arteries, and reduced stress. We set out with a stack of studies, a panel of parched testers, and a full fridge to find the best-tasting, healthiest brews available.

Beer is nutritious if consumed in moderation 

  • That beer is fat-free and cholesterol free? 

  • Beer has a relaxing effect on the body thereby reducing stress. 

  • It can help you sleep better 

  • It helps prevent heart disease and improves the blood circulation 

  • It has proven to have positive effects on elderly people. It helps to promote blood vessel dilation, sleep, and urination. 



An average beer contains the following:

0mg of cholesterol 
0g of fat 
13g of carbohydrate 
25mg of sodium 
protein, calcium, potassium, phosphorus and vitamins B, B2, and B6 

Beer in cooking is deeply rooted in Western Europe. Beer is incomparable as a cooking tool. With its unique flavors and versatilities is it unmatched. Due to the fact that alcohol has a much lower boiling temperature than water, it evaporates quickly while cooking your recipe and thereby only leaves the characteristic taste of the beer.

Beer also contains vitamin B6, which prevents the build-up of amino acid called homocysteine that has been linked to heart disease. 

What’s interesting is that it was proven (New England Journal of Medicine – Nov. 1999) that those who drank one beer a week compared to those who drank one beer a day experienced no variance in reducing stroke risks. It is said that light to moderate drinkers will decrease their chances of suffering a stroke by 20%.

THE GOLD MEDALIST SWIMMER, MICHAEL PHELPS


MICHEAL PHELPS IMAGE

Michael Fred Phelps II (born June 30, 1985) is a retired American swimmer and the most decorated Olympian of all time with 22 medals. Phelps also holds the all-time records for gold medals (18, double that of the next highest record holders), gold medals in individual events, and Olympic medals in individual events for a male. In winning eight gold medals at the 2008 Beijing Games, Phelps took the record for the most first-place finishes at any single Olympic Games. Five of those victories were in individual events, tying the single Games record. In the 2012 Summer Olympics in London, Phelps won four golds and two silver medals.
Phelps is the long course world recordholder in the 100 metres butterfly, 200 metres butterfly and 400 metres individual medley as well as the former long course world recordholder in the 200 metres freestyle and 200 metres individual medley. He has won a total of 71 medals in major international long-course competition, 57 gold, 11 silver, and 3 bronze spanning the Olympics, the World, and the Pan Pacific Championships. Phelps's international titles and record-breaking performances have earned him the World Swimmer of the Year Award six times and American Swimmer of the Year Award eight times. His unprecedented Olympic success in 2008 earned Phelps Sports Illustrated magazine's Sportsman of the Year award.
After the 2008 Summer Olympics, Phelps started the Michael Phelps Foundation, which focuses on growing the sport of swimming and promoting healthier lifestyles. He expects to do further work with his foundation after the 2012 Olympics, which he has said will be his last.
